Short description
Selective vascular KATP channel antagonist
-
Biological description
Selective vascular KATP channel antagonist (IC50 values are 15 and 6 µM for SUR2B/ Kir6.2 and SUR2B/ Kir6.1 channels respectively). Also Kir6.2δ26 channel inhibitor (IC50 = 5.0 µM). Displays no activity at cardiac, pancreatic or skeletal kATP channels. Displays diuretic properties.
